Dairyland Park

Overview: Dairyland Park is rated 4.6/5 from 327 Google reviews. Reviews most often describe it as clean and well kept and spacious with room for dogs to run. Amenities: Reviewers often mention shade and tree cover. Crowd: Reviews describe a sense of community among regular visitors.

Very large, spaced out area with lots of surrounding trees for shade. As a dog mom, I loved that I could take my fur babies through the water, and sit by the side without being on top of others. Very clean park. A hidden gem

This is a cute park for kids and dogs in a community. If you don't have one you have the other lol. It has a few picnic tables and one shaded area with tables. It is a larger size splash pad that my kids really enjoyed. The large rocks are fun but kids of course want to climb them when wet and one of our kids slipped, so I advise telling your kids to not climb them before going. Bathrooms aren't super close to splash pad,but they are next to dog park a clean.
